Oracle数据恢复全解析:完全恢复与不完全恢复时间对比
2025-07-04 05:36:02 来源:技王数据恢复

引言段
在现代企业中,数据的安全性与完整性至关重要。数据丢失或损坏的情况时有发生,尤其是在使用Oracle数据库时,用户面临着如何有效恢复数据的挑战。Oracle数据恢复全解析将帮助您理解完全恢复与不完全恢复的时间对比,助您在关键时刻做出明智决策。无论是由于误操作、系统崩溃还是其他原因,了解这些恢复方法将为您的数据安全提供保障。
常见故障分析
在Oracle数据库的使用过程中,用户可能会遭遇多种故障,导致数据丢失或损坏。以下是几类典型故障:
1. 硬件故障
例如,某公司因硬盘损坏导致数据库无法访问,数据丢失严重。这种情况下,恢复时间取决于硬件的替换速度和数据备份的完整性。
2. 软件故障
另一种常见情况是软件崩溃,例如数据库升级失败,导致数据损坏。用户在这种情况下需要评估恢复的复杂性与时间成本。
3. 人为错误
如误删除重要数据,用户往往会感到绝望。选择合适的恢复策略将直接影响恢复的时间与效果。
操作方法与步骤
工具准备
在进行Oracle数据恢复之前,您需要准备以下工具:Oracle Recovery Manager(RMAN)、数据备份文件、恢复介质等。
环境配置
确保您的恢复环境与原环境相似,包括数据库版本、操作系统等,以减少兼容性问题。配置好网络连接,确保可以访问备份文件。
操作流程
1. 完全恢复流程:使用RMAN连接到数据库,执行以下命令:
RMAN> STARTUP MOUNT;
RMAN> RESTORE DATABASE;
RMAN> RECOVER DATABASE;
RMAN> ALTER DATABASE OPEN;
完全恢复通常需要较长时间,但能确保数据的完整性。
2. 不完全恢复流程:在某些情况下,您可能只能进行不完全恢复,例如:
RMAN> STARTUP MOUNT;
RMAN> RESTORE DATABASE;
RMAN> RECOVER DATABASE UNTIL TIME 'YYYY-MM-DD HH24:MI:SS';
RMAN> ALTER DATABASE OPEN;
这种方法虽然快速,但可能导致部分数据丢失。
注意事项
在进行数据恢复时,务必备份当前数据状态,以防恢复失败。选择合适的恢复点也至关重要,确保尽量减少数据丢失。
实战恢复案例
案例一:硬件故障恢复
设备类型:Oracle服务器;数据量:500GB;恢复用时:6小时;恢复率:98%。用户因硬盘损坏,使用备份文件进行完全恢复,成功恢复绝大部分数据。
案例二:软件崩溃恢复
设备类型:虚拟机;数据量:200GB;恢复用时:3小时;恢复率:95%。用户因软件更新失败导致数据损坏,采用不完全恢复策略,部分数据丢失。
案例三:人为错误恢复
设备类型:本地服务器;数据量:100GB;恢复用时:1小时;恢复率:100%。用户误删除数据,通过快速恢复工具成功找回所有误删数据。
常见问题 FAQ 模块
Q: 格式化后还能恢复吗?A: 是的,使用专业的恢复工具可以恢复格式化的数据,但成功率因情况而异。
Q: NAS误删数据有救吗?A: 绝大多数情况下,NAS数据误删可以通过备份恢复或数据恢复软件找回。
Q: 恢复过程中会影响现有数据吗?A: 完全恢复可能会覆盖现有数据,不完全恢复则相对安全。
Q: 数据恢复需要多长时间?A: 恢复时间取决于数据量和恢复方法,完全恢复通常耗时较长。
Q: 如何选择恢复工具?A: 选择知名的恢复软件,并根据具体故障类型进行选择。
Q: 数据恢复后能否保证数据完整性?A: 完全恢复通常能保证数据完整性,但不完全恢复可能存在风险。
立即行动,保护您的数据安全
如您在使用Oracle数据库时遇到数据丢失或恢复困难,欢迎立即拨打 免费咨询。技王在全国设有9大直营网点,覆盖北京、上海、杭州、武汉、成都、沈阳、长春、深圳、重庆,随时为您提供专业的数据恢复服务。